habeas corpus

英[ˌheɪbiəs ˈkɔ:pəs]美[ˌheɪbiəs ˈkɔrpəs]

人身保护权;人身保护法

habeas corpus 英语释义

英语释义

  • the civil right to obtain a writ of habeas corpus as protection against illegal imprisonment
  • a writ ordering a prisoner to be brought before a judge
